What does "crypto-" mean?

  1. noun Digital money that exists only as records on a computer network, kept secure by mathematics rather than issued or guaranteed by a government or bank.
    "He keeps a small amount of crypto on an exchange and the rest offline."
  2. noun The wider industry, technology and community built around cryptocurrencies.
    "She left banking to work in crypto."
  3. noun Cryptography: the study and practice of encoding information so that only intended parties can read it.
    "The paper was published at a crypto conference in the 1990s."
